Thesis (D.M.)--Northwestern University, 1989.
This dissertation provides the reader with an extensive survey of standard piano teaching literature at the intermediate levels of study. Further, this project serves to answer essential questions related to the teaching of pedagogical keyboard literature: What is the grade level of a particular piece? Where can I locate a particular piece? What currently available collections are devoted to a composer's works and who publishes them? Are there any unique pedagogical considerations related to the works of a given historical style?Subjects--Topical Terms:

One chapter is devoted to each of the four main historical periods: Baroque, Classic, Romantic, and Twentieth century. Each chapter is subdivided into the following sections: (1) a brief survey of the significant keyboard works of a particular historical period; (2) an overview of pedagogical issues as they apply to a given style; and (3) a graded list of works, alphabetized by composer, including their location in representative standard multi-composer and multi-period collections.
520
$a
The repertoire list was selected from nearly four centuries of keyboard literature. Many of the pieces that are included in the graded list are widely used by teachers and other works are relatively unknown works written by minor master composers, yet suitable for teaching. This survey is limited in scope and is not intended to examine every published collection that is currently available. Due to the vast amount of teaching material that is currently published, this survey is limited to a representative sampling of multi-composer, multi-period, and single-composer collections that have become highly respected in the field of piano teaching. Ten anthologies or series, comprised of a total of forty-six volumes, have been consulted. Each solo composition in each of these forty-six volumes has been graded and listed in this survey. A total of one thousand, two hundred and forty-seven compositions has been thoroughly examined and carefully evaluated with respect to level of advancement or degree of difficulty. The following grade levels have been used for this survey: elementary, advancing elementary, early intermediate, intermediate, advancing intermediate, moderately difficult, early advanced, and advanced.
